Vladimir Putin 'may meet Rex Tillerson' amid deepening crisis over Syria
The London Telegraph ^ | April 11, 2017 | Roland Oliphant

Posted on 04/11/2017 12:14:44 PM PDT by 2ndDivisionVet

Vladimir Putin will meet Rex Tillerson, the US secretary of state, on Wednesday amid a deepening confrontation over Russia’s role in Syria and a US missile strike against a government-controlled airbase there.

Mr Tillerson arrived in Moscow on Tuesday evening for talks with Sergey Lavrov, the Russian foreign minister, which are expected to focus on US calls for the Kremlin to drop its support for Syrian leader Bashar al-Assad.

The Kremlin has refused to confirm whether there are plans for Mr Putin to meet Mr Tillerson in line with its policy of not announcing such meetings before they happen....
